Confidently find and hire contractors globally | Create a free account →

Best SQL freelancers for hire

SQL: Harness the power of your data

SQL (structured query language) is the industry-standard language for managing and manipulating data within relational database management systems (RDBMS). From simple data retrieval to complex analytical queries, SQL empowers businesses to unlock valuable insights hidden within their data. Hiring a skilled SQL freelancer can transform your data management processes, improve decision-making, and ultimately drive business growth.

What to look for in a SQL freelancer

When searching for a SQL freelancer, look for demonstrable experience with the specific RDBMS used by your organisation (e.g., MySQL, PostgreSQL, Microsoft SQL Server, Oracle). A strong understanding of database design principles, data normalisation, and query optimisation is crucial. Excellent problem-solving skills and the ability to translate business requirements into efficient SQL queries are also essential.

Main expertise areas to inquire about

SQL encompasses various specialisations. Depending on your needs, consider inquiring about the freelancer's expertise in:

  • Data modelling and database design
  • Data warehousing and ETL (extract, transform, load) processes
  • Performance tuning and query optimisation
  • Stored procedures and functions
  • Specific RDBMS platforms (MySQL, PostgreSQL, SQL Server, Oracle)
  • Data visualisation and reporting

Relevant interview questions

Prepare targeted interview questions to assess the freelancer's SQL proficiency. Here are a few examples:

  • Explain your experience with different types of SQL joins.
  • Describe your approach to optimising a slow-performing query.
  • How do you ensure data integrity within a database?
  • Walk me through your experience with data warehousing and ETL processes.
  • How would you approach designing a database for [describe a relevant scenario]?

Tips for shortlisting candidates

Shortlisting can be streamlined by focusing on:

  • Relevant experience: Prioritise freelancers with experience in your industry or with similar projects.
  • Portfolio and case studies: Review their previous work to assess the quality and complexity of their SQL skills.
  • Client testimonials: Gauge their professionalism and communication skills through feedback from previous clients.
  • Technical assessments: Consider using coding challenges or practical tests to evaluate their SQL proficiency.

Potential red flags

Be mindful of these potential red flags:

  • Lack of specific RDBMS experience: Ensure the freelancer has experience with the platform you use.
  • Vague or inconsistent responses to technical questions: This could indicate a lack of genuine expertise.
  • Poor communication skills: Clear and effective communication is crucial for successful collaboration.
  • Unwillingness to provide references or portfolio examples: This could be a sign of inexperience or a lack of confidence in their abilities.

Typical complementary skills

SQL often goes hand-in-hand with other technical skills. Freelancers with expertise in the following areas can provide a more comprehensive solution:

  • Data analysis (e.g., Python with Pandas, R)
  • Data visualisation (e.g., Tableau, Power BI)
  • Cloud computing (e.g., AWS, Azure, Google Cloud)
  • NoSQL databases (e.g., MongoDB, Cassandra)

What problems a SQL freelancer can solve for you

A skilled SQL freelancer can address various data-related challenges, including:

  • Improving data management processes: Streamlining data entry, storage, and retrieval.
  • Generating insightful reports and dashboards: Transforming raw data into actionable business intelligence.
  • Developing and maintaining databases: Building and managing robust and scalable database systems.
  • Automating data-driven tasks: Creating scripts and procedures to automate repetitive tasks.
  • Migrating data between systems: Seamlessly transferring data between different database platforms.

For example, a retail business might hire a SQL freelancer to analyse sales data and identify top-selling products, enabling them to optimise inventory management and marketing strategies. A healthcare provider could use SQL expertise to build a patient database, improving patient care and operational efficiency. A financial institution might leverage SQL to analyse transaction data and detect fraudulent activities.

Access marketplace benefits

Create a free account today and access 100,000+ industry-vetted freelancers, independent consultants and contractors for your next project.

Get started with YunoJuno today and see why users love us

Hire in hours with YunoJuno

The new way of finding and working with contractors. Save time and money from today.

Are you a freelancer? Join YunoJuno

As seen in
Forbes logo
Campaign logo
The Times logo
BBC logo